Summary/Abstract: The Romanian communist regime produced centralized media, characterized by the intertwining of censorship and propaganda and an extended economic control. Following the regime change,free publicity has taken over the place of socialist controlled publicity without transition. However,neither the new political actors nor the media had the basic knowledge, rules, and norms for operating a democratic press system. As a result, the press of the first years of the regime change featured a state of politicization, tabloidism, and commercialism.
